python安装pwn
时间: 2023-08-27 15:14:41 浏览: 214
要在Mac上安装pwn,您可以按照以下步骤进行操作:
1. 确保您的Mac已安装Homebrew包管理器。如果尚未安装,请打开终端并运行以下命令:
```
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
2. 安装pwn工具集。在终端中运行以下命令:
```
brew install pwntools
```
3. 现在,您可以在终端中使用pwn工具集执行各种pwn任务了。您可以编写和调试漏洞利用、利用二进制漏洞等等。
请注意,pwn工具集是一个非常强大的工具集,需要一定的计算机安全和二进制知识才能使用。确保您了解自己在做什么,并且只在合法和授权的范围内使用它。
相关问题
python安装pwn库
要在Python中安装pwntools库,首先需要确保已经安装了Python以及相关的依赖项。根据引用和引用中提到的内容,你可以使用以下命令来安装Python和pip:
对于Python 2:
```
$ apt-get install python python-pip python-dev
```
对于Python 3:
```
$ apt-get install python3 python3-pip python3-dev
```
一旦安装完成,你可以使用pip来安装pwntools库。根据引用中提到的内容,建议在Python 3环境下学习pwntools。因此,你可以运行以下命令来安装pwntools库:
```
$ pip3 install pwntools
```
这将会使用pip3来安装pwntools库到Python 3环境中。安装完成后,你就可以在Python中使用pwntools库来进行pwn开发了。
linux中python安装pwn库
要在Linux中安装pwn库,你可以按照以下步骤进行操作:
1. 首先,确保你已经安装了Python解释器和pip包管理器。你可以在终端中运行以下命令来检查它们是否已安装:
```
python --version
pip --version
```
如果这些命令显示了版本信息,说明它们已经安装了。否则,你需要先安装它们。
2. 接下来,你可以使用pip来安装pwn库。在终端中运行以下命令:
```
pip install pwn
```
这将会从Python包索引中下载并安装pwn库及其依赖项。
3. 安装完成后,你可以在Python代码中导入pwn库并开始使用它。例如:
```python
import pwn
# 在这里编写你的代码
```
现在你可以使用pwn库提供的功能来进行二进制漏洞开发和漏洞利用。
请注意,安装pwn库可能需要一些额外的系统库和依赖项。如果你在安装过程中遇到了任何错误,请根据错误信息来解决它们,并确保你的系统满足pwn库的要求。
阅读全文